Hours
Wednesday - Sunday: 12 - 6pm
Fridays in July and August: 12 - 8pm
Closed Monday & Tuesday With the exception of Learning Programs & Workshops
The Queens Museum of Art is officially closed in observance of the following holidays: New Year’s Day, Thanksgiving, and Christmas Day.
Admission
Admission is by suggested donation. Adults: $5 Senior and Children: $2.50 Members and Children under five: Free
